摘要: Combiner是MR程序中Mapper和Reducer之外的一种组件(本质是一个Reducer类) Combinr组件的父类就是Reducer Conbimer只有在驱动类里设置了之后,才会运行 Combiner和Reducer的区别在于运行的位置: map sort copy sort(shuf 阅读全文
posted @ 2020-07-29 23:46 孙晨c 阅读(280) 评论(0) 推荐(0) 编辑
摘要: @ 排序概述 排序是MapReduce框架中最重要的操作之一。 Map Task和ReduceTask均会默认对数据按照key进行排序。该操作属于Hadoop的默认行为。任何应用程序中的数据均会被排序,而不管逻辑上是否需要。 黑默认排序是按照字典顺序排序,且实现该排序的方法是快速排序。 对于MapT 阅读全文
posted @ 2020-07-29 17:39 孙晨c 阅读(424) 评论(0) 推荐(0) 编辑